About 2-[(2R,6S)-2,6-dimethylmorpholin-4-yl]-1-(5-methoxy-2-methyl-1H-indol-3-yl)ethanone
2-[(2R,6S)-2,6-dimethylmorpholin-4-yl]-1-(5-methoxy-2-methyl-1H-indol-3-yl)ethanone (PubChem CID 951271) has the molecular formula C18H24N2O3
and a molecular weight of 316.40 g/mol. Its IUPAC name is 2-[(2R,6S)-2,6-dimethylmorpholin-4-yl]-1-(5-methoxy-2-methyl-1H-indol-3-yl)ethanone.

What is the SMILES notation for 2-[(2R,6S)-2,6-dimethylmorpholin-4-yl]-1-(5-methoxy-2-methyl-1H-indol-3-yl)ethanone?
The canonical SMILES for 2-[(2R,6S)-2,6-dimethylmorpholin-4-yl]-1-(5-methoxy-2-methyl-1H-indol-3-yl)ethanone is COc1ccc2[nH]c(C)c(C(=O)CN3C[C@@H](C)O[C@@H](C)C3)c2c1.
What is the InChIKey of 2-[(2R,6S)-2,6-dimethylmorpholin-4-yl]-1-(5-methoxy-2-methyl-1H-indol-3-yl)ethanone?
The InChIKey is VMLGUIRJVNAVEN-TXEJJXNPSA-N. The full InChI is InChI=1S/C18H24N2O3/c1-11-8-20(9-12(2)23-11)10-17(21)18-13(3)19-16-6-5-14(22-4)7-15(16)18/h5-7,11-12,19H,8-10H2,1-4H3/t11-,12+.
What are the key properties of 2-[(2R,6S)-2,6-dimethylmorpholin-4-yl]-1-(5-methoxy-2-methyl-1H-indol-3-yl)ethanone?
2-[(2R,6S)-2,6-dimethylmorpholin-4-yl]-1-(5-methoxy-2-methyl-1H-indol-3-yl)ethanone has a molecular weight of 316.40 g/mol, XLogP of 2.78, 4 rotatable bonds, 1 hydrogen bond donors, and 4 hydrogen bond acceptors.
